public String getImageURL()
{
IAsset asset = getAsset("closed");
return asset.buildURL(getRequestCycle());
}
Bind the image symbol of the Script to the imageURL
property of the page.

> I've recently picked up on Tapestry and am very impressed.
>
> But how do I pass the path of a component's private-asset through to a
> script?
>
> I have tried the following:
>
> --------Component.jwc-----------
> <specification class="net.sf.tapestry.BaseComponent">
>
> <component id="script" type="Script">
> <static-binding
> name="script">/test/Script.script</static-binding>
> <binding name="image" property-path="assets.image"/>
> </component>
>
> <private-asset name="closed" resource-path="/test/image.gif"/>
>
> </specification>
> --------Component.jwc-----------
>
> But when I look at the script generated it looks like this:
>
> PrivateAsset[/test/image.gif]
>
> This is from the PrivateAsset.toString method, is it possible that
> toString is being called rather than buildURL or am I missing something
> obvious?
